What they do

A Medical Records or Coding Supervisor oversees the work of technicians and medical coders, manages healthcare records and ensures that patient information is safely and accurately maintained. Works in a healthcare facility or hospital.

Regional Professional Coding Supervisor General Summary:
The Professional Coding Supervisor is accountable for the management and coordination of system-wide coding functions. This position is responsible for identifying and solving coding related issues, implementing performance improvement and other operational initiatives as needed. Ensures staff adherence to productivity, quality, and compliance standards and is supportive of departmental metrics and organizational goals and objectives.
Requirements:
Associate's degree in HIM or relevant health care field or 5+ years of relevant Coding experience
Foundational Coding Credential:
Current certification in good standing as a Certified Professional Coder (CPC), AAPC; or Certified Coding Specialist-Physician-based (CCS-P), AHIMA Minimum of 1 year of lead or supervisory experience Epic experience. Excellent organizational, communication, and interpersonal skills. Knowledge of Microsoft Word, Excel, and Internet applications Bachelor's degree preferred. Optum and/or 3M encoder experience preferred.
Essential Functions & Responsibilities:
Provide oversight and day-to-day management of the hospital professional coding. Develop and implement methods to attain and maintain coding metrics. Establish reporting tools/dashboards to monitor performance. Communicate regulatory information to coding specialists and assist in compliant application of regulations. Provide coding assistance in relation to recording documentation, data collections, data retrieval and data interpretation. Contribute to, coordinates and/or implements processes to comply with coding, billing, regulatory or data registry requirements relating to areas of responsibility. Collaborate with other departments or programs. Maintain effective communication regarding coding issues with physicians and other hospital department staff. Participate in organizational team meetings and workshops. Performs other duties as assigned. These may include but are not limited to: Maintaining a current knowledge base of department processes, protocols and procedures, pursuing self-directed learning and continuing education opportunities, and participating on committees, task forces, and work groups as determined by management.
